Tomlin Hints That More Roster Moves Could Be Forthcoming Prior To Patriots Game

The Pittsburgh Steelers have now finalized their initial 53 man roster for the 2015 season, but during his Saturday press conference, head coach Mike Tomlin hinted that a more moves might be forthcoming prior to the team’s Thursday night regular season opener against the New England Patriots.

“We’re going through a few procedural things with the roster cutdown. Some of those things are ongoing and probably will be ongoing for the next day or so as other teams make their decisions and we evaluate what’s available,” said Tomlin. “Just normal procedure for us. So we acknowledge that we’ve got a little bit of our business done, obviously with the game coming on Thursday, but we’ll continue to keep an eye on what’s going on in other cities and the things that may help us be better.”

The Steelers initial 53 man roster includes just seven healthy offensive linemen and two true running backs. Because of that, one could easily speculate that they are watching the final round of cuts in order to add players at those two positions.

One move that we know will happen next week is the placing of center Maurkice Pouncey on injured reserve with the designated to return tag. That move will likely take place on Tuesday.
